Visitor policy update: with the opening of the fourth floor at Quellan House, all guests must be met at the second-floor landing and escorted by a Torvik Labs employee at all times. Visitors may not hold the stairwell door for anyone. To admit your escorted guest through the new floor's entry panel, use the code below.

door code, yagap-bahof: bdg-O-05

☐ Door sensor recall — brief every new starter. Veltrix Systems recalled the Model K door sensors on floors 2 and 4 of the Ambersgate building. Affected doors may not register a badge tap on the first try. Tell starters: tap twice, wait for the green light, do not force the door. Log any failures with Facilities before noon. Until replacement units arrive, the service corridor door stays on manual override. Use the temporary pass code below to release it.

door code, kawip-bagap: bdg-HQEWH-4

Hello plugin authors,

Next Thursday, Corbexa will run a disaster-recovery drill for the RestockRoute vending-machine restock planner. During the failover window, plugin callbacks will be replayed against the standby scheduler, so please ensure your handlers are idempotent and tolerate duplicate route assignments. No customer restock data will be altered. To re-register your plugin against the standby environment during the drill, authenticate with the recovery passphrase provided below.

vault phrase of hahip-tajeg = quenax-briath-briax

**Q: How do I check deploy status without pinging the whole team?**

Easy — just message DeployDuck in the #releases channel. Type "status" plus the service name (like "status cartwheel-api") and it'll tell you what's live, what's rolling out, and any failures. If DeployDuck seems stuck or gives weird answers, reach out to the platform team here:

pager mailbox: silael.sorwyn.tamius@zemvarsys.corp